Jiangfeng Du is a leading researcher at the forefront of nanomedicine and biomedical engineering, with a primary focus on the innovative application of liquid metal nanomaterials for cancer therapy. His most notable contribution is the pioneering development of transformable gallium-based liquid metal nanoparticles for tumor radiotherapy sensitization. In his landmark 2022 study, Du was the first to report the use of nanosized gallium-indium alloys to enhance the efficacy of radiotherapy, demonstrating how these unique, shape-shifting particles can improve tumor targeting and radiation absorption.
